Edward R. Murrow Quotes: We must not confuse dissent with disloyalty. When the loyal opposition dies, I think the soul of America dies with it.
         

We must not confuse dissent with disloyalty. When the loyal opposition dies, I think the soul of America dies with it.


Edward R. Murrow
